DVD player lost its LCD display
I own a JVC XV-S502 dvd player. I came back to my dorm today and turned on my dvd player. The lcd display never lit up but other than that the player works fine. I have no idea why this has happened. I checked the manual and all it has is info to make the lcd brighter. Any suggestions?

Is this a standard player or a portable player.
I assume its a standard home player and the LCD readout that counts time and chapters on the front of the player is out. If so, play around with the controls you saw in the manual for changing the brightness. I know it could be completely different, but on my Sony player, the front display got turned off somehow and it turned out it was actually a brightness setting for the display.
